Lin Xing’s paper “Observation of photon antibunching with only one standard single-photon detector” was published in Review of Scientific Instruments(Vol.92, Issue.1, 013105 (2021))

The second-order photon correlation function g(2)(τ) is of great importance in quantum optics. It was usually believed that two single-photon detectors should be used to acquire g(2)(τ). Here, we demonstrate a new method to measure and extract g(2)(τ) with a standard single-photon avalanche photodiode (dead-time = 22 ns) and a single-channel time acquisition module. This is realized by shifting the coincidence counts of interest to a time window not affected by the dead-time and after-pulse of the detection system using a fiber-based delay line. The new scheme is verified by measuring g(2)(τ) from a single colloidal nanocrystal.
